My intention is to analyse how a new family unit, different in many respects from the traditional patrilinear group ... lawsuit translation to spanishThe Julio-Claudian dynasty comprised the first five Roman emperors: Augustus, Tiberius, Caligula, Claudius, and Nero. This line of emperors ruled the Roman Empire, from its formation (under Augustus, in 27 BC) until the last of the line, emperor Nero, committed suicide (in AD 68).
